From the Weekend Herald (Herald Cars, The Good Oil, page F1, 22 January, 2011) ...
Let's hear it for ... Harrison Ford
Owners of Fords in the US like to call their cars "Harrison" after the Hollywood actor, says website webuyanycar.com.

Other favourite nicknames for cars in general are Betty, Betsy and Bess. Almost 56 per cent of those polled by the website said they gave their cars pet names. Bertie, Daisy, Bertha and Meg are popular, as are Charlie, Herbie and Bob. One respondent said he called his car God, as "it moves in mysteriuos ways".

About 60 per cent of women and 41 per cent of men said they felt emotionally attached to their car, while 25 per cent of those shed a tear when they parted company with their vehicle.

Red and blue cars were the most likely to be given a name. Grey and green vehicles pretty much remained nameless.
